About Michael P. Jasso
Michael P. Jasso grew up in San Antonio, Texas, and earned his Bachelor's Degree from Trinity University, focusing on political science education. After college, he began his career teaching at a Montessori School in San Antonio. While teaching, he pursued a Master’s Degree in Educational Psychology, which seamlessly transitioned into his legal career.
After meeting his wife, Heather, who hailed from Albuquerque, Michael moved there and taught Humanities at Amy Biehl High School. During this time, he was the first teacher from New Mexico chosen for the Supreme Court StreetLaw Institute in Washington D.C., a program designed to help educators convey complex legal concepts to students. This experience rekindled his passion for law, leading him to apply to the University of New Mexico School of Law.
Michael completed his J.D. in two and a half years, graduating Order of the Coif and Magna Cum Laude. During law school, he externed at the New Mexico Supreme Court and clerked with Montgomery & Andrews. Upon graduation, he joined Guebert Bruckner P.C., where he gained valuable insights into how insurance companies and defense firms handle cases.
At Guebert Bruckner P.C., Michael developed expertise in managing personal injury, bad faith, and construction defects claims. His educational background enhances his ability to communicate effectively with clients, ensuring they fully understand their claims and available options.
